深度解析棋牌游戏测试,技术、策略与用户体验的优化之道测试棋牌游戏

深度解析棋牌游戏测试,技术、策略与用户体验的优化之道测试棋牌游戏,

本文目录导读:

  1. 第一部分:棋牌游戏测试的技术基础
  2. 第二部分:棋牌游戏测试的策略与方法
  3. 第三部分:用户体验测试与优化
  4. 第四部分:总结与展望

随着中国游戏产业的蓬勃发展,棋牌游戏作为娱乐、竞技和社交的重要载体,吸引了无数玩家的关注,棋牌游戏的复杂性和多样性使得测试工作变得异常重要,无论是游戏规则的完善、功能的稳定,还是用户体验的优化,都需要专业的测试团队和科学的方法来确保棋牌游戏的成功运营,本文将从技术、策略和用户体验三个方面,深入探讨棋牌游戏测试的关键环节和优化之道。

第一部分:棋牌游戏测试的技术基础

游戏测试框架的设计与实现

棋牌游戏测试框架是整个测试过程的核心,它决定了测试效率和测试质量,一个好的测试框架需要具备以下特点:

  • 模块化设计:将测试功能划分为独立的模块,便于管理和维护。
  • 自动化测试工具:利用自动化工具如Python、JavaScript等,实现对游戏逻辑的自动化验证。
  • 性能测试模块:针对游戏的性能进行压力测试,确保在高玩家 concurrent情况下系统依然稳定。
  • 兼容性测试模块:测试不同设备和平台(如手机、平板、电脑)的兼容性。

在测试一款桌面版棋牌游戏时,测试团队可能会使用Python编写自动化测试脚本,覆盖游戏的多个功能模块,包括初始登录、游戏规则、计分系统等。

游戏性能优化与测试

游戏性能是影响用户体验的重要因素,在测试阶段,需要通过以下手段优化游戏性能:

  • 内存优化:测试游戏运行时的内存占用,确保在高玩家 concurrent情况下不会出现内存溢出问题。
  • CPU资源使用测试:通过模拟高强度玩家 concurrent,测试游戏对CPU资源的占用情况,确保系统不会出现卡顿。
  • 图形性能测试:测试游戏的图形渲染性能,确保在不同分辨率和配置下都能流畅运行。

测试团队可能会使用专业的性能测试工具如JMeter,对游戏的多个场景进行性能测试,确保游戏在各种环境下都能稳定运行。

游戏安全测试

游戏安全是测试工作中的另一个重要环节,主要包括:

  • 漏洞扫描:使用漏洞扫描工具对游戏代码进行扫描,查找潜在的安全漏洞。
  • 安全测试用例设计:设计针对游戏的攻击性测试用例,验证游戏的防护机制是否有效。
  • 数据安全测试:测试游戏对用户数据的处理过程,确保数据不会被泄露或篡改。

在测试一款 Poker 游戏时,测试团队可能会设计一个恶意脚本,试图通过漏洞攻击游戏中的资金系统,验证游戏的漏洞防护机制是否有效。

第二部分:棋牌游戏测试的策略与方法

玩家行为模拟与规则验证

玩家行为模拟是测试过程中非常关键的一环,通过模拟不同玩家的行为,测试团队可以验证游戏规则是否符合预期。

  • 玩家行为模拟:使用行为分析工具对真实玩家的行动进行模拟,验证游戏规则是否符合玩家的使用习惯。
  • 规则验证:测试团队会设计多个规则验证场景,确保游戏规则在不同情况下都能正确执行。

在测试一款德州扑克游戏时,测试团队可能会模拟不同玩家的下注、翻牌、加码等行为,验证游戏规则在这些场景下的正确性。

游戏市场反馈分析

游戏市场反馈是测试工作的重要来源,通过分析玩家的反馈,测试团队可以及时发现和解决问题。

  • 用户反馈收集:通过问卷调查、游戏内反馈机制等方式,收集玩家对游戏的评价和建议。
  • 市场趋势分析:测试团队会分析当前市场的热门游戏和趋势,确保棋牌游戏符合玩家的口味。

测试团队可能会发现许多玩家对游戏中的某些规则感到困惑,于是他们会立即调整游戏规则,确保玩家能够顺畅地进行游戏。

A/B测试与版本优化

A/B测试是游戏测试中常用的一种方法,用于比较两个版本的游戏,验证哪个版本更优。

  • 版本对比测试:测试团队会将玩家随机分配到两个不同的版本中,分别测试两个版本的游戏体验。
  • 数据统计分析:通过统计两个版本的玩家行为数据,验证哪个版本更受欢迎。

在测试一款新上线的游戏时,测试团队可能会使用A/B测试,比较新版本和旧版本的游戏在玩家留存率、游戏时长等方面的表现。

第三部分:用户体验测试与优化

用户体验反馈收集

用户体验测试的核心是收集玩家的反馈,并通过这些反馈进行优化。

  • 用户访谈:测试团队会与玩家进行访谈,了解他们在游戏中遇到的问题和建议。
  • 用户测试日志分析:通过分析玩家的游戏日志,测试团队可以发现玩家在游戏中的常见问题。

测试团队可能会发现许多玩家在游戏初期感到困惑,于是他们立即调整了游戏的初始界面和提示信息,确保玩家能够快速上手。

游戏体验优化

用户体验优化是测试工作的重要目标。

  • 界面优化:测试团队会根据玩家的反馈,优化游戏的界面设计,确保玩家能够轻松找到游戏规则和操作流程。
  • 提示优化:测试团队会优化游戏中的提示信息,确保玩家能够快速理解游戏规则。

在测试一款新上线的游戏时,测试团队可能会发现许多玩家在翻牌后没有收到足够的提示信息,于是他们立即调整了游戏的提示设计,确保玩家能够清楚地了解接下来的步骤。

游戏更新与迭代

游戏更新是测试工作中不可或缺的一部分,测试团队会根据玩家的反馈和市场趋势,定期对游戏进行更新和迭代。

  • 功能更新:根据玩家的反馈,测试团队会增加或删除某些功能,确保游戏始终符合玩家的需求。
  • 版本迭代:测试团队会根据市场趋势,推出新的游戏版本,吸引更多的玩家。

测试团队可能会发现许多玩家对游戏中的积分系统感到不满,于是他们立即调整了积分系统的规则,确保玩家能够获得更多的积分奖励。

第四部分:总结与展望

棋牌游戏测试是一个复杂而繁琐的过程,需要测试团队具备深厚的专业知识和丰富的实践经验,通过技术、策略和用户体验的优化,测试团队可以确保游戏的稳定运行和玩家的愉快体验,随着游戏技术的不断发展,棋牌游戏测试的工作将更加注重智能化和自动化,以应对日益复杂的测试需求。

随着人工智能和大数据技术的广泛应用,棋牌游戏测试的工作将更加智能化和数据化,测试团队可能会利用机器学习算法,自动分析玩家的反馈和游戏日志,从而更高效地优化游戏体验,随着游戏平台的多样化,测试团队还需要具备更强的多平台测试能力,以确保游戏在不同平台上都能稳定运行。

棋牌游戏测试是一个充满挑战和机遇的领域,需要测试团队不断学习和创新,以应对日益复杂的游戏环境。

深度解析棋牌游戏测试,技术、策略与用户体验的优化之道测试棋牌游戏,

发表评论